Explore Rajkot: A 7-Day Adventure

Monday, August 21: City Arrival

In the afternoon, visit Watson Museum and Library, which houses an impressive collection of artifacts and exhibits on Rajkot's history. In the evening, head to Jubilee Garden, a beautiful park known for its serene atmosphere and lush greenery.

  • Watson Museum and Library: Estimated cost - INR 50,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Jubilee Garden: Free entry, Time spent - 1 hour
Tuesday, August 22: Spiritual Journey

Begin your day with a visit to Swaminarayan Temple, a stunning architectural marvel known for its intricate carvings. In the afternoon, explore Aji Dam, a scenic reservoir offering breathtaking views of the surrounding landscapes. As the evening approaches, make your way to Lal Pari Lake, a serene spot perfect for a leisurely walk.

  • Swaminarayan Temple: Free entry,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Aji Dam: Estimated cost - INR 100,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Lal Pari Lake: Free entry, Time spent - 1 hour
Wednesday, August 23: Cultural Delights

Immerse yourself in Rajkot's rich culture by visiting the Rotary Dolls Museum in the morning. This unique museum showcases a vast collection of dolls from different countries. In the afternoon, head to Kaba Gandhi No Delo, the childhood residence of Mahatma Gandhi. Explore the museum inside, which provides insights into Gandhi's life. In the evening, indulge in some local delicacies at the lively Race Course Ring Road Food Street.

  • Rotary Dolls Museum: Estimated cost - INR 20,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Kaba Gandhi No Delo: Estimated cost - INR 30, Time spent - 1.5 hours
  • Race Course Ring Road Food Street: Estimated cost - INR 200, Time spent - 2 hours
Thursday, August 24: Wildlife Excursion

Embark on a thrilling safari adventure at Gir National Park in the morning. Get a chance to spot majestic Asiatic lions in their natural habitat. In the afternoon, visit the nearby Khambhalida Caves, an ancient Buddhist archaeological site. These rock-cut caves feature intricate carvings and sculptures. Spend the evening at Funworld Rajkot, an amusement park with exciting rides and entertainment options.

  • Gir National Park: Estimated cost - INR 500, Time spent - 4 hours
  • Khambhalida Caves: Free entry, Time spent - 1.5 hours
  • Funworld Rajkot: Estimated cost - INR 300, Time spent - 3 hours
Friday, August 25: Shopping Extravaganza

Explore the colorful markets of Rajkot in the morning, starting with Bangdi Bazaar, known for its traditional handicrafts and jewelry. Indulge in some retail therapy at Crystal Mall, a modern shopping complex with a variety of stores. In the evening, visit Ishwariya Park, a serene garden offering panoramic views of the city.

  • Bangdi Bazaar: Cost varies,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Crystal Mall: Cost varies, Time spent - 3 hours
  • Ishwariya Park: Free entry, Time spent - 1 hour
Saturday, August 26: Historical Exploration

Discover Rajkot's historical landmarks by visiting the Pradyuman Park and Bal Bhavan in the morning. These attractions offer insights into the city's past and provide a fun learning experience for all ages. In the afternoon, explore Mahatma Gandhi High School, where Mahatma Gandhi received his primary education. Spend the evening at Rajkumar College, an architectural gem and one of the oldest educational institutions in India.

  • Pradyuman Park and Bal Bhavan: Estimated cost - INR 50,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Mahatma Gandhi High School: Free entry,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Rajkumar College: Estimated cost - INR 100, Time spent - 2 hours
Sunday, August 27: Farewell Rajkot

On your last day in Rajkot, take a peaceful morning walk at Khandheri Park, a serene garden with beautiful landscapes. In the afternoon, visit the Rotary Midtown Dolls Museum, another unique doll museum showcasing a diverse collection. Bid farewell to Rajkot with a delicious dinner at one of the city's popular restaurants.

  • Khandheri Park: Free entry,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Rotary Midtown Dolls Museum: Estimated cost - INR 20,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Dinner at a local restaurant: Estimated cost - INR 500, Time spent - 2 hours
